Environmental Protection in Perth Receives Another Boost with the Swan Alcoa Landcare Program

The Swan Alcoa Landcare Program (SALP) continues to protect the environmental biodiversity of our Swan Region with more than $330,000 in grants awarded to 59 on ground projects at this morning’s annual SALP Funding Ceremony.

Perth NRM working to protect the threatened Glossy Leaf Hammer Orchid

The Glossy Leaf Hammer Orchid, (Drakea elastica) is a slender stemmed orchid found only in Western Australia.

Two Decades of Landcare Celebrated

One of Australia’s longest and most successful landcare initiatives, the Swan Alcoa Landcare Program (SALP), is celebrating 20 years of protecting and enhancing the Swan and Canning rivers catchments.
